Dual-vessel towed marine electromagnetic exploration technology is a new electromagnetic exploration technology used to detect oil and gas reservoirs.Compared with the traditional marine electromagnetic exploration technology,this technology works in a way that does not require a receiver to be placed on the seafloor in advance and is more flexible to use.Applying this technology for data acquisition,the signal has less attenuation and can collect geoelectric information from deep below the seafloor,and this technology is now widely used in gas hydrate exploration.With the development of marine controlled source electromagnetic technology,the related theoretical research tends to be mature and the equipment is gradually improved,but the processing technology of digital data is still lagging behind.There are many procedures for processing marine controlled source electromagnetic data,but there are few systematic data processing software,and the existing software has a single function,cumbersome operation steps,and poor user experience.Therefore,it is of great practical significance to develop a complete set of controlled source electromagnetic data processing software with two ships and multiple cables.This paper proposes a complete set of digital data processing method based on the project of "deep-sea dual-vessel towed marine electromagnetic exploration system development",combines digital processing technology with software development technology,and develops a dual-ship multi-chain cable controlled-source electromagnetic data visualization processing software.Compared with other traditional controlled-source electromagnetic data processing software,this software can meet the demand for processing controlled-source electromagnetic data of dual-ship multi-link cable with more complete functions and higher processing efficiency.The software is based on the windows platform,using a mixture of C++ and Matlab language programming,using Duilib interface rendering technology and multi-threaded development technology together with the development of the software.From the perspective of function,the software can be divided into three parts,one is the original signal display part,which includes the multi-link cable receiver data selection and loading module,transmit current signal display module,navigation data visualization module;the second is the data analysis part,which is mainly the current signal quality analysis module;the third part is the data processing part,which includes two parts: parameter setting and data analysis,of which Parameter setting mainly includes receiver parameter setting,transmitter parameter setting,navigation parameter setting and rotation parameter setting.The data analysis includes the generation of MVT/PVT curves and apparent resistivity calculation.Considering that Matlab has complete graphics processing functions and powerful drawing functions,the graphing of apparent resistivity is chosen to be done by Matlab.Finally,each function of the software was tested with real data,and the effectiveness of the software and the accuracy of the data processing results were verified by comparison.
